Time cut f or fun By Yolanda Cerda There is more to life than just school and homework. To escape the hum-drum routine of school, many stu- dents enjoy a variety of out- side activities. The student can then demonstrate his unique talents and abilities. Activities can range from shopping in the mall to play- ing with the Santa Ana Winds Band. But some students seize the opportunity to en- gage in a hobby or interest which is both satisfying and exciting. A good example is Angel Cardoza who for a year has been involved in LULAC, the League of United Latin American Citizens. The club tries to promote Latin Ameri- can involvement in the com- munity. He has participated in LULAC ' s club sponsored activities such as the men- udo cook-off and the bike-a- thon. Angel says that through LULAC, You get to meet new friends and it ' s fun. With available time and willingness, students are able to escape their respon- sibilities with hobbies. Yvonne Rios, who enjoys drawing says, Drawing takes me away from every- day problems. I can express my style, feelings, and my own personality. v Working at C and R Clothiers provides Jennifer Lexcen with on hand sales experience and extra spending money. Many students try to find a job to suit their needs as well as flexibility with hours. A Yvonne Rios displays her artistic skills with portraits of movie stars Robert Redford and Sir Lawrence Olivier with great pride. Marilyn Mon- roe is one of Yvonne ' s favorite personalities for drawing. Senior Annie Lieu takes dance jazz classes in her spare time. It ' s like an escape, says Annie, you get to learn new techniques and routines from others, which is very satisfying. 12 Outside Acriviries
